Saddam caricature Synonyms
We can't find synonyms for the phrase "Saddam caricature", but we have synonyms for terms, you can combine them.Saddam Synonyms
SC abbreviation
SC is an abbreviation for Saddam CaricatureWhat does SC stand for?
SC stands for "Saddam Caricature" Definitions for Saddam
Definitions for Caricature
- (noun) a poor, insincere, or insulting imitation of something
- (noun) a work that imitates and exaggerates another work for comic effect
- (noun) the representation of something in terms that go beyond the facts